Why I Febfast
This February, I am taking part in Febfast in memory of my dear friend Nat, who left us far too soon to suicide. Losing Nat has been incredibly hard. As one of the last people in touch with her, the weight of knowing I couldn’t do anything to bring her back has stayed with me. Her loss is a painful reminder of how deeply suicide and depression affect not only those who are struggling, but also the people left behind who love them. By doing Febfast, I hope to honour Nat’s life, raise awareness, and support others who may be walking a similar path, whether they are struggling themselves or grieving someone they love. “I was glad, Nat, that you were among us. Your life we honour, your memory we cherish, In grief at your death, but in gratitude for your life and for the privilege of sharing it with you.” Thank you for supporting this cause and for helping keep conversations around mental health alive. 💛
Every 24 seconds, someone in Australia reaches out to Lifeline for help
That’s more than 3,000 people every single day who just need someone to listen. By skipping the sip for one month, I’m not only giving my body a break – I’m helping make sure Lifeline can be there, anytime and anywhere, for the people who need it most.
It’s a small challenge for me, but it could mean life-changing support for someone else.
Together we can ensure Lifeline can continue to be there 24/7 so that no one has to face their toughest moments alone.
